Blodplättar, or blood pancakes in english, are a dish served in Finland, Sweden and Norway made of whipped blood, water or pilsner, flour and eggs. It is similar to black pudding, but is thinner and crispier. Blodplättar may be fried in a frying pan. The pancakes are usually served with crushed lingonberries, sometimes with pork or reindeer meat.

Blodplättar (in Swedish; blodpannekaker in Norwegian, veriohukainen, verilätty or verilettu in Finnish; verikäkk in Estonian), or blood pancakes in English are a dish served in Finland, Estonia, Sweden and Norway made of whipped blood (typically reindeer blood), water or pilsner, flour and eggs. Finnish Blood Pancakes : This dish is served in Finland, where it is known as veriohukainen. In Sweden, it's referred to as blodplätter. The mixture of these pancakes contain blood as a handy egg substitute, which helps bind the milk and flour together. The blood inside the pancakes renders it dense, savory, and dark.
